Congratulations: Emily’s a CNA

By drew on July 14, 2008

What's a CNA? A Certifiied Nursing Assistant.

 

After completing her first semester of nursing school on her way to becoming an RN, Emily could take the test to become a CNA and this is what she did this past Saturday. Passing this test will enable her to be able to work in a nurse-like environment in a hospital or a nursing home until she fully graduates nursing school. She was stressing out about the test, but apparently for no reason because she passed with no problems after absolutely spanking the test. Good work, baby!

Please Mind the Gap Between Your Job and Being Fired

By drew on November 26, 2007

What happens when you mock the London Underground (affectionately known as the Tube) and make spoofs of the announcments and post them on your website? Most likely nothing, unless you are the official announcer, aka Emma Clarke. You may have heard that today she was relieved of her duties for criticizing the London Underground. An Underground spokesman had this to say, "Some of the spoof announcements are very funny. But Emma is a bit silly to go round slagging off her client's services." Read more of the story here.

 

I was only able to download one of the spoof announcements before her site (EmmaClarke.com) went down from the rush of traffic; but now have the rest of them. You can download the Emma Clarke spoof announcement (MP3), "We'd like to remind our American tourist friends that you are almost certainly talking too loud" right here. To stream other of the spoofs, look to the right. Now I know to keep it down on the Tube; wouldn't want to out-noise the drunks!
